Shallum (2)
PeopleWhat is the meaning of Shallum (2) in the Bible?
Shallum was the fifteenth king of Israel who assassinated Zechariah and reigned for one month before being killed by Menahem. He was the son of Jabesh and may have been a Gileadite from beyond the Jordan.
SIGNIFICANCE
The brief reign of Shallum highlights the instability and violence that characterized the kingdom of Israel during this period.
